DESIGN AND ANALYSIS OF TESTS ON THE PROCEDURES FOR ESTIMATING VARIANCE COMPONENTS IN FARM ANIMALS
In an effort to fully account for the effects of model variability, this study adopted a two-stage nested design with unequal replications. The frequency approach's five various variance component estimate methods, which were chosen at random, were also contrasted in this study. The modified maximum likelihood method was recommended for use because it has the lowest minimum variances among these techniques, which included the Analysis of Variance (ANOVA), the Quasi-Maximum-Likelihood (QML), the Modified Likelihood (ML), the Restricted Maximum-Likelihood (REML), and the Modified Maximum Likelihood (MML).
